Immersive World-Building: Beyond the Screen

Scott’s films excel at transporting audiences. “Blade Runner” and “Gladiator” didn’t just tell stories; they built entire worlds. This trend is accelerating, moving beyond the confines of the movie screen. Consider:

  • Virtual Reality (VR) and Augmented Reality (AR): VR and AR experiences allow for direct interaction with these crafted environments. Think immersive VR games based on “Alien” or AR apps that overlay historical insights onto real-world locations, inspired by “Gladiator.”
  • Location-Based Entertainment: Themed entertainment spaces, escape rooms, and interactive experiences based on movies are on the rise. The “Alien” franchise could easily inspire high-stakes, atmospheric escape rooms. Historical recreations, akin to aspects of “Gladiator,” could offer interactive historical tours.

Did you know? Disney’s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ge is a prime example of immersive world-building, creating a fully realized environment that extends beyond the film’s narrative. The next generation of themed entertainment will aim to push these boundaries further, incorporating haptic feedback and personalized experiences.

Visual Storytelling: The Rise of High-Quality Content

Scott’s mastery of visuals has always been a hallmark of his work. The future of entertainment is, without question, visual. It’s about content quality.

  • 4K and Beyond: The demand for higher resolution will continue to grow. 8K and even greater resolutions will become more common in both film production and home viewing experiences.
  • HDR and Enhanced Color: High Dynamic Range (HDR) technology, which expands the range of colors and brightness, already makes visual content more vibrant. This tech is moving out of the top-end TVs and becoming more prevalent.
  • Innovative Filmmaking Techniques: Expect more utilization of technologies such as AI-powered visual effects and the incorporation of interactive elements within the visuals, allowing viewers to influence aspects of the storytelling.

The Evolution of Historical and Biographical Content

Scott’s exploration of historical narratives, such as “Gladiator” and “Exodus: Gods and Kings,” has set a standard for historical content, and biopics are forever a part of the landscape. Future trends here include:

  • Authenticity and Research: Audiences are more discerning than ever. Success in this area requires deep dives into historical records, careful attention to detail, and consultation with experts.
  • Diverse Perspectives: Expect more stories that highlight marginalized voices and explore history through different lenses.
  • Hybrid Storytelling: Blending documentary elements with dramatic storytelling. Think docudramas and hybrid formats that use historical footage and interviews to enrich fictional narratives.

Real-life example: The success of series such as “The Crown” illustrates the demand for well-researched, visually stunning historical dramas.

Fan Engagement and the Power of Community

The future of entertainment is not just about consuming content but about actively participating in it. The legacy of Scott, and the passion his movies incite, provides the foundation for strong fan interaction.

  • Interactive Storytelling: Platforms will emerge that allow viewers to influence the narrative. This could be through branching storylines, or even the chance to collaborate with other viewers on the same story.
  • Expanded Universes: Expect more franchises to have integrated content that goes beyond the main story, providing comics, games, and other media to build the worlds of our favorite stories.
  • Social Media Integration: Seamless integration of social media. Imagine watching a movie and participating in discussions, polls, or trivia contests in real-time.
